It uses two 21700 batteries and a super bright LED with up to 6800 lumens. This flashlight as a thrower has a longer throw and higher output than IF22A. It can also be used as a powerbank to charge other devices. SP60 offers reliable illumination and is readily available for different situations.

Battery Level Indicator The indicator shows the power status for 5 seconds after turning SP60 on. Green = remaining battery power is good. Red = remaining battery power is poor Flashing Red = critical power (less than 30%), please replace or recharge battery as soon as possible.

Strobe mode may cause seizure in persons with photosensitive epilepsy. Operating SP60 for a long time in high powered modes will quickly heat up the flashlight. This is normal. Pay close attention to the proper installation of the battery. Always check that the positive end of the battery faces the flashlight’s head.
